I didn't understand why the people voted the way they did in these two elections - Commissioner and Recorder. Anderson seemed like more of the status quo and establishment. I liked Wright's ideas to expand the commission to better represent the county and to limit spending. As for the Recorder race, I must have missed some mailing or something because I couldn't find much from either candidate in regards to any plans, just descriptions of the office they were running for which does nothing to tell me of their goals. I was concerned with the claim that Smith didn't provide input into the new system being developed at the office. Seemed to me the Commissioner race was the more critical and the few voters just voted back in the establishment. Again I think sheeple and lack of imagination among the voters. :P Just wish more had come out to vote and more became educated about the candidates instead of voting based on name recognition.
